18 Bible Verses about Dead To Sin
Most Relevant Verses
So you also, consider yourselves dead to sin but alive to God in Christ Jesus.
I have been crucified with Christ; it is no longer I who live, but Christ who lives in me; and the life I now live in the flesh I live by faith in the Son of God, who loved me and gave himself for me.
Those who belong to Christ Jesus have crucified the flesh with its passions and desires.
If with Christ you died to the elementary principles of the world, why, as if you still belonged to it, do you submit to regulations such as,
Here is a trustworthy saying: if we died with him, we will also live with him;
He himself bore our sins in his body on the tree, so that we might die to sin and live for righteousness; by his wounds you have been healed.
Likewise, my brethren, you have died to the law through the body of Christ, so that you may belong to another, to him who was raised from the dead, in order that we may bear fruit to God.
We know that our old self was crucified with him so that the body of sin might be done away with, that we should no longer be slaves to sin.
For if we have been united with him in a death like his, we shall certainly also be united with him in a resurrection like his.
Or do you not know that all of us who were baptized into Christ Jesus were baptized into his death?
But now, by dying to what once held us, we have been released from the law so that we serve in the new way of the Spirit, and not in the old way of the written code.
For the love of Christ controls us, because we are convinced that one has died for all; therefore all have died.
Put to death, therefore, whatever belongs to your earthly nature: sexual immorality, impurity, passion, evil desire and greed, which is idolatry.
